Stepping inside Norm’s is like stepping back to a simpler time. The cafe was purchased by Tom and Vicki Collins in 1975, and the dining area is filled to the brim with trinkets from the past. It’s been nearly 50 years, but nothing much has changed about Norm’s. It’s even stayed in the same family!

The diner is open Monday through Friday from 6: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m., Saturday from 6: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m., and Sunday from 8: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. They specialize in all of your favorite American bites, including all-day breakfast.

The breakfast menu is extensive, with everything from fully-loaded omelets to the diner’s specialty biscuits and gravy. However, the lunch and dinner options are well-worth perusing when you’re in the mood for it. The sandwiches, burgers, and myriad dinner entrees are all made with the same amount of love and care!
